Output 20e82ece7743c6373e2a6e44941fd5e38bd2a47f862128b48333fb300edbe604:4

value
1590327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0168273ec9812706bb510861ffd2b15f2f473fbf OP_EQUALVERIFY OP_CHECKSIG
address
18SStdKhM6bBSyhKJbeRSCcciwpXPTnmb
transaction
20e82ece7743c6373e2a6e44941fd5e38bd2a47f862128b48333fb300edbe604
spent
true